Output fb66bec78e291fcb1edc889bd41ac63dddfd153ef136db3ba52f86bd1e86a7a9:1

value
1521526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ee6d92c2e1ba55813705c29a74cac267d9b0c14a OP_EQUAL
address
3PRi1V55CqSY2wCEaTWkQuQva9wdad7ZLd
transaction
fb66bec78e291fcb1edc889bd41ac63dddfd153ef136db3ba52f86bd1e86a7a9
confirmations
383480
spent
true